Apply the Property of Negative Integer Exponents to solve 3^−4. The answer should not contain any exponent expression or decimals.(1 point)

2 answers

Using the Property of Negative Integer Exponents, we know that a negative exponent can be rewritten as the reciprocal of the base raised to the positive exponent.

Therefore, 3^−4 can be rewritten as 1/3^4.

To find 1/3^4, we can first find 3^4.
3^4 = 3 * 3 * 3 * 3 = 81.

Therefore, 3^−4 = 1/3^4 = 1/81.

So, the answer is 1/81.
